On Numerical Modeling of Elastoplastic Responses of Shell Structures
Efficient numerical algorithms for modeling of elastoplastic responses of shell structures are proposed. Both small strain and large strain formulations are presented. The small strain formulation employs a realistic highly nonlinear and temperature dependent hardening model, while an isothermal free energy-based formulation incorporating isotropic and kinematic hardening is applied for the large strain analysis. An associative flow rule and von Mises yield criterion are employed. In order to ensure a high convergence rate in the global iteration approach, algorithmic tangent moduli are derived for both formulations. Numerical example demonstrates robustness and efficiency of the proposed algorithms.
